Transaction 15182769446065622ff621a585f5751b94c827f90a52595f07631a62609babb4
1 Input
1 Output
-
15182769446065622ff621a585f5751b94c827f90a52595f07631a62609babb4:0
- value
- 82233
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b0ab6cf663a25cfc8ed804f2855317728e84e5be OP_EQUAL
- address
- 3HoADAgmdSqChuwiDyBHo16vpXD3WFDEQ3